In Person at Lapis Theater
DUNE* Mini-Comics Night is where folks are invited to create the contents of a black and white, 5.5” x 8.5” printed anthology within a limited amount of time, in one evening with no prompts or themes. Create whatever you want but it must be physical and finished by the end of the night.
An exclusive edition of the book will be published and distributed to only the contributors at the following DUNE meet-up.

In Person at Lapis Theater
Join us for our Limited Twice a Month Works in Progress: In the Pursuit of Happiness Edition! This special series follows the same format as our regular Works in Progress sessions, but with a themed twist. Each month features a unique theme, and participants are invited to share pieces that either interpret the theme in their own way or incorporate it into their work.

In Person at Lapis Theater
Collections exists in a space in between the publishing world and the open mic—a third space. A space to present finished and polished work; a space to come together with peers and allies to share fresh ideas; a space to forge community.
